Prada Candy Gloss Perfume Review: A Detailed Exploration

At first spritz, Prada Candy Gloss bursts forth with a vibrant energy. The initial impression is undeniably sweet, dominated by a luscious cherry note that is neither artificial nor cloying. It's a ripe, juicy cherry, reminiscent of freshly picked fruit, avoiding the overly sugary sweetness often found in gourmand fragrances. This fruity top note is immediately brightened and lifted by the sparkling citrusy quality of orange blossom. This isn't a sharp, zesty orange; instead, it's a more delicate, floral interpretation of the citrus fruit, adding a layer of airy lightness that prevents the cherry from becoming too heavy.

The heart of the fragrance unfolds slowly, revealing a subtle creamy warmth that beautifully complements the initial fruity burst. While specific notes aren't explicitly listed beyond the cherry and orange blossom, there's a suggestion of a subtle muskiness and a hint of vanilla that adds depth and complexity. This creamy undertone prevents the fragrance from being solely a fleeting fruity scent, lending it a more substantial and enduring presence on the skin. It's this masterful balance of contrasting notes – the bright, juicy top notes and the warm, creamy heart – that elevates Prada Candy Gloss above the average sweet perfume.

The dry down is where the fragrance truly reveals its sensual nature. The initial burst of fruit gradually fades, leaving behind a soft, lingering sweetness that clings to the skin. The musk and vanilla notes become more prominent, creating a warm, comforting base that is both intimate and alluring. This subtle, skin-scent-like dry down is incredibly sophisticated, demonstrating the perfumer's skill in crafting a fragrance that evolves gracefully over time.

Longevity and Sillage:

Prada Candy Gloss boasts impressive longevity, lasting for several hours on the skin. The sillage, or the projection of the fragrance, is moderate. It's not an overwhelming scent that fills a room, but it leaves a noticeable, pleasant trail that subtly announces your presence. This moderate sillage makes it perfect for both daytime and evening wear, ensuring it's appropriate for various occasions without being overpowering.

Is Prada Candy Gloss Discontinued?

At the time of writing this review, Prada Candy Gloss is *not* officially discontinued. However, availability can vary depending on region and retailer. It's always advisable to check directly with Prada or authorized retailers for the most up-to-date information on its availability. Discontinuations can happen unexpectedly in the fragrance industry, so staying informed is crucial if this is your signature scent.
